Flute, Oboe, Clarinet in Bb 1, Clarinet in Bb 2, Bassoon, Trumpet in Bb 1, Trumpet in Bb 2, Horn in F, Trombone, Tuba, Mallet Percussion, Timpani, Percussion, Violin 1, Violin 2, Violin 3, Viola, Violoncello, Contrabass — Begin The Sorcerer's Apprentice in a quiet and mysterious manner. At m. 16, the dramatic statement breaks the spell. Maintain a steady tempo from the allegro until two measures before the end. It is important to work for a full dynamic range in the orchestra from the piano in the bassoon solo at m. 23 to the vigorous brass statement of the melody at m. 59. After the grand pause in m. 106, the piece has a sudden and surprising ending.Performance Time: 1:15String editing by Amy Rosen. The only selection to be featured in the original "Fantasia" film and sixty years later in "Fantasia 2000!" is arranged here in a version your students can play. Playable by string orchestra or full orchestra, this arrangement avoids much of the introductory material to get right into the most familiar parts. An orchestra classic.
